Update PR workflow: CI → UAT (Patty) → QA (Regina) → CTO → merge

Reorder the review pipeline so cheap/fast stages gate expensive ones:
CI (free) runs first, then Patty validates E2E on MiniMax, then
Regina does deep code review on Sonnet, then Nancy reviews last.

- POLICIES.md: rewrite PR Workflow with 6-step ordered pipeline
- Patty SOUL.md: establish her as first reviewer, add CI-must-pass rule
- Patty HEARTBEAT.md: check CI status before E2E, report results for Regina
- Regina SOUL.md: flip from "review first" to "review after UAT"
- Regina HEARTBEAT.md: skip PRs without CI + E2E validation
